Why we write this
Most coating content is a sales page wearing a lab coat
Search for “polyurea vs epoxy” and you will find a hundred articles that say polyurea is stronger, faster and better, then ask for your phone number. Almost none of them tell you what a glass transition temperature is, why it decides whether a garage floor in Phoenix survives its first August, or the specific circumstances in which epoxy is genuinely the smarter purchase. That gap is the reason this journal exists.
We are a dedicated polyurea, polyaspartic and polyurethane applicator working across Arizona — residential garages and pool decks through Phoenix, Mesa, Scottsdale, Chandler and Gilbert, industrial floors and containment linings in Tucson and the southern corridor, and freeze-thaw-rated specifications up in Flagstaff and Prescott where the whole design problem inverts. Working all three of those climates with the same material family teaches you quickly which properties actually matter and which ones are marketing.
Nearly every article here started as a conversation on a driveway. A homeowner in Gilbert holds three bids that range by a factor of three and cannot tell what the difference is. A facility manager in Tucson needs a dock apron back in service before the 5 a.m. inbound and has been told epoxy needs a week. Somebody in Scottsdale has a two-year-old floor that peeled a perfect oval under the driver’s side tire and wants to know whether it was the product or the installer. Those are answerable questions, and the answers involve real numbers — elongation percentages, CSP profile grades, mil thickness, moisture test methods, cure windows.
The other reason this exists is that Arizona is genuinely a different technical problem than the places most coating literature was written for. A garage slab in Phoenix can sit above 140°F in August, which is inside the softening range of common floor epoxies. A pool deck in Chandler takes ten hours of direct ultraviolet a day for five months straight. A warehouse floor in Tucson swings thirty degrees between a 5 a.m. dock opening and a 3 p.m. shift change. Meanwhile a garage in Flagstaff at seven thousand feet is fighting freeze-thaw cycling and de-icing salt. Advice written for a mild, shaded, temperate slab does not transfer, and following it is how a perfectly good product ends up failing in eighteen months.
So the standard we hold ourselves to here is simple. Every statement here should be traceable to a material property or a field observation. Cost discussion should name the variables that move a price rather than dangle a number that cannot survive contact with your actual slab. And when a competing material is the right call for a particular space, we should say so plainly instead of pretending our product family is universal. If polyurea is wrong for your floor, you deserve to hear that before you pay for it, not after.
